Dependant on what I've noticed and browse in other sources, the oval (P) evidence mark wasn't released till 1908. Before that time, Winchester marked “OF” (outdoors fitted) on the bottom of your barrel beneath the forend stock for that mail purchase barrels. I have see several of them on Product 1885 Single Shot Rifles that predate 1908.
Through the nineteen sixties the growing price of skilled labor was making it more and more unprofitable to provide Winchester’s common layouts, since they demanded substantial hand-function to finish. In particular, Winchester’s flagship Product 12 pump shotgun and Product 70 bolt-motion rifle with their machined forgings could no longer compete in price tag with Remington’s cast-and-stamped 870 and seven hundred. Appropriately S. K. Janson fashioned a different Winchester style and design team to advance the usage of “contemporary” engineering style approaches and production principles in gun style and design.

Ned Schwing mentioned in his reference e-book to the Model 1890 & 1906 that Winchester started evidence marking them in 1908… I have no idea if that is definitely precise, but will suppose that it's. The “WP” evidence mark was used after the barrel and receiver were being mated, assembled and concluded. This is highly evident on the firearms made from the late teens through early 30s when the blue flaked (popped) off when the proof was struck about the receiver body.
